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44082847849 0251718277 1364669758 296 670110581
1486430 27
1486430 27
8480982764 7314180950 89 540045
All about undefined
Interested in learning more?
1486430 27
8480982764 7314180950 89 540045
See more
4127593 7418821256
9988 80190730 11671 39
See more
046298 5977604361 650626
872772 434 64586 30
See more